美國虛擬主機也是建站用戶常用的主機之一,但在使用過程中美國虛擬主機用戶可能會遇到網站出現Service Unavailable的錯誤提示,這種情況一般是由于網站超過系統所限制的資源所導致,因為美國虛擬主機是從獨立主機劃分出來的共享資源的獨立單元,因此每個美國擬主機使用的系統資源都有所限制,當使用的資源超過限制就會出現錯誤提示。下面美聯科技小編就來分析下引起美國虛擬主機占用過多資源的原因。
原因1:訪問量過大
美國虛擬主機的特性是比較適合搭建個人網站、論壇等小規模網站,如果規模較大且在線人數較多的網站,就很容易造成對美國虛擬主機的請求過大而超出資源限制。對于這類情況建議在網站高峰時段可以適當關閉互動功能,如限制注冊、評論、發帖等,從而降低對美國虛擬主機資源的請求。
原因2:插件過多
如果安裝的插件過多對于美國虛擬主機來說是不可取的,插件功能一樣會消耗美國虛擬主機的CPU、內存資源等,因此除了必須插件以外,盡量減少多余插件的安裝,已保障美國虛擬主機的正常運行。
原因3:網站不合理
美國虛擬主機搭建的網站最好以圖文模板為主,減少Flash視頻、下載等多媒體內容元素,因為這些網站元素會大量消耗美國虛擬主機資源,同時還會影響網站的訪問速度,是不適合美國虛擬主機的網站元素。
原因4:數據庫設置問題
如果美國虛擬主機網站的數據庫結設置不合理,會嚴重影響網站的運行速度,并且也會重復占用線程導致IIS被鎖,自然也就會過多占用美國虛擬主機資源。因此美國虛擬主機用戶在搭建多個網站,不要隨意設置網站的數據庫,同時需要定期的刪除多余的數據庫、數據庫表格。
原因5:程序代碼問題
目前多數美國虛擬主機網站都是PHP語言的,但如果PHP程序編寫不合理從而存在死循環或冗余的數據模塊的話,就會導致美國虛擬主機負載,因此會過高占用CPU,所以在編寫的程序中要盡量優化好程序結構,避免出現重復冗余的語句。
原因6:網站遭遇攻擊
如果網站遭遇網絡攻擊,勢必會在短時間對美國虛擬主機發起大量請求而導致資源負載,同時還會消耗大量的流量和帶寬。所以在使用美國虛擬主機的過程中需要做好安全工作,定期進行安全檢查和掃描,一旦發現美國虛擬主機網站有什么異常要及時處理。
以上內容就是關于導致美國虛擬主機占用過多系統資源的常見原因,可供美國虛擬主機用戶進行參考。總的來說美國虛擬主機技術讓建站更為簡單方便,但可利用的資源有限,所以在使用過程中需要多加注意,從而確保美國虛擬主機網站的正常運行。
美聯科技專注IDC業務十七年,是優質的IDC商之一,專業提供各種網絡解決方案,其中包括美國服務器、美國VPS租用、美國虛擬空間租用、網站建設、CDN云加速等,竭誠為廣大客戶提供更優質更貼心的服務。對于有美國虛擬空間租用需求的用戶也提供了很多解決方案,美國虛擬空間不但價格非常便宜,而且性能各方面優質可靠,也適合新手站長用來建站。以下是部分美聯科技提供的美國虛擬空間配置介紹:
操作系統 | 網站空間 | 程序語言 | 數據庫 | 流量 | 企業郵局 | 頂級域名 | 價格 |
CentOS 7 | 2G | PHP 5.x/6.x/7.x | MySQL(最多2個) | 20G/月 | 2個 | 2個 | 200/年 |
CentOS 7 | 4G | PHP 5.x/6.x/7.x | MySQL(最多4個) | 30G/月 | 5個 | 4個 | 300/年 |
需要了解更多詳情的用戶,歡迎移步到美聯科技官網:美國虛擬空間,或者聯系美聯科技客戶經理QQ:22652082,進行咨詢了解。
美聯科技已與全球多個國家的頂級數據中心達成戰略合作關系,為互聯網外貿行業、金融行業、IOT行業、游戲行業、直播行業、電商行業等企業客戶等提供一站式安全解決方案。持續關注美聯科技官網(http://www.dnkscl.cn),獲取更多IDC資訊!